How this book is organized: A roadmap I organized this book into three sections with 13 chapters. Part 1 introduces Ia C and how you, as an individual, write it. •Chapter 1 defines Ia C and its benefits and principles. The chapter explains that the book has examples in Python, run by Hashi Corp Terraform, and deployed to Google Cloud Platform (GCP). I also discuss the tools and use cases you’ll encounter in your Ia C journey. •Chapter 2 dives into the principle of immutability and how you can migrate existing infrastructure resources to Ia C. It also covers the practices of writing clean Ia C. •Chapter 3 offers a few patterns for dividing and grouping infrastructure resources into modules. Each pattern includes an example and a list of use cases. •Chapter 4 covers how to manage dependencies among infrastructure resources and modules and decouple them with dependency injection and some common patterns. Part 2 describes how to write and collaborate on Ia C as a team. •Chapter 5 organizes the practices and considerations for expressing Ia C in different repository structures and sharing it across your team. •Chapter 6 provides an infrastructure testing strategy. It describes each type of test and how to write them for Ia C. •Chapter 7 applies continuous delivery to Ia C. It covers a high-level view of branching models and how your team can use them to change infrastructure. •Chapter 8 provides techniques to build secure and compliant Ia C, including testing and tagging. Part 3 covers how to manage Ia C across your company. •Chapter 9 applies immutability to infrastructure changes, including an example for blue-green deployments. •Chapter 10 refactors a large body of Ia C to improve its maintainability and mitigate the blast radius of failed changes to one codebase. •Chapter 11 describes reverting Ia C and rolling forward changes to the system. •Chapter 12 addresses the use of Ia C to manage cloud computing costs. It includes an example for cost estimation of Ia C. •Chapter 13 completes the book with practices to manage and update Ia C tools. You will find that many concepts build on each other throughout the book, and it may help to read the chapters in order if you have not previously practiced Ia C. Otherwise, you can choose the sections that best apply to the challenges you face in your Ia C practice.
Jideon F Marques
Python And Terraform [EPUB ebook]
Python And Terraform [EPUB ebook]
قم بشراء هذا الكتاب الإلكتروني واحصل على كتاب آخر مجانًا!
لغة البرتغالية ● شكل EPUB ● صفحات 100 ● ISBN 3410006485683 ● حجم الملف 13.7 MB ● الناشر Clube de Autores ● مدينة Joinville ● بلد BR ● نشرت 2024 ● الإصدار 1 ● للتحميل 24 الشهور ● دقة EUR ● هوية شخصية 10154159 ● حماية النسخ Adobe DRM
يتطلب قارئ الكتاب الاليكتروني قادرة DRM